How much does a Program Director make in Wake County, NC?
A Program Director in Wake County, North Carolina, earns an average yearly salary of around $85,276. This salary can vary based on experience and other factors. Some Program Directors may earn more, while others may earn less.
Program Directors oversee programs within organizations. They plan, manage, and evaluate programs. They work to ensure that programs meet goals and run smoothly. This role is important and often comes with a good salary. The range of salaries for Program Directors in Wake County shows a wide spread, from about $59,360 to over $101,670 per year. Most Program Directors fall in the middle of this range, earning between $67,000 and $90,000 annually.
